Servitor accused of assisting Odisha cop to enter Srimandir suspended

Puri: Taking disciplinary action against the servitor accused of assisting a police officer to enter into Srimandir amid lockdown restrictions, Pujapanda nijog of the Jagannath Temple, Puri, has suspended him from service.

Pujapanda servitor Laxminarayan Pujapanda has been suspended from his duty for flouting the lockdown norms, informed Pujapanda Nijog’s Secretary Madhav Pujapanda.

Violating the restrictions imposed by the state government to fight COVID-19, the Pujapanda servitor had allegedly taken Badachana Police Station IIC Deepak Kumar Jena into the temple for darshan of deities. He will be placed under suspension till further order, source said.

Jena had allegedly barged into Srimandir along with his family members through the South Gate on April 19 evening despite being resisted by a havildar. Based on a complaint lodged by the havildar with Singhadwara police, Jena and his family members were detained. Later, DGP Abhay suspended him from service for his misconduct. Also, a case has been registered against the suspended police officer at the Singhadwara Police Station, Puri.
